Job Description:

SUMMARY

Performs the highest level of non-degreed accounting and/or utility billing functions, including, but not limited to, analyzing and resolving billing and accounts payable issues, customer and financial database and records maintenance and other complex financial and records functions.  Performs lead account clerk work involving administration of contracts, preparation and monitoring of department budgets, training, development and coordination of support staff, preparation of fiscal reports, and/or maintenance of complex financial and billing records and the handling of complex and sensitive financial matters.

Positions allocated to this classification report to a designated supervisor or manager and work under general supervision with limited direction.  Work in this class is distinguished from higher classes by its lack of management responsibility and from lower classes by its performance of high level account clerical responsibilities, including acting as lead worker to other account clerks.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S

Depending on area of assignment:

Prepares, monitors, verifies and balances departmental budget or other complex financial records and reports.

Understands, applies and trains other personnel in the proper billing of all utility services.

Interacts with other departments to ensure appropriate billing of utility services to customers.

Analyzes quotes and reviews, manages and administers departmental contracts.

Performs technical bookkeeping work, including journal entries to update the general ledger.

Accesses, interprets and determines the best methods to extract information from appropriate computer and manual systems to analyze, prepare and/or resolve financial and billing issues.

Analyzes large demand accounts to make billing corrections.

Analyzes and resolves the most sensitive and complex billing issues.

Interacts with vendor representatives and handles complaint issues.

Acts as the department resource for procurement of needed services, supplies, materials, and equipment.

Processes, reconciles and audits travel requests and reports and ensures compliance with appropriate City policies and procedures.

Compiles and prepares varied and complex financial reports for supervisors, internal and external auditors and/or local and state agencies.

Trains other City employees to understand and comply with departmental and organizational policies and procedures.

Attends work on a continuous and regular basis.

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E

Graduation from high school or possession of an acceptable equivalency diploma, and five years of experience in accounting, bookkeeping or other revenue-related accounting work, including two years in municipal accounting or finance performing complex clerical and sub-professional accounting functions; or an equivalent combination of education, training and experience which provide the required knowledge, skills and abilities.

An Associate of Arts degree with at least 12 semester hours of accounting can be substituted for one year of experience;

Typing at a speed acceptable to departmental needs.

        KNOWLEDGE,  SKILLS AND ABILITIES

Thorough knowledge of financial operations, bookkeeping principles and standard office terminology, procedures and routines.

Thorough knowledge of City budgeting process.

Thorough knowledge of administration of grants.

Thorough knowledge of the City’s ordinances, policies, systems and procedures governing its financial administration.

Thorough knowledge of applicable City computer and manual purchasing, billing and customer systems.

Thorough knowledge of the City’s purchasing rules, regulations and procedures, as well as the administration of contracts for goods and services.

Thorough knowledge of accounting principles and procedures, and application to accounting functions.

Thorough knowledge of accounts payable and receivable, banking practices and general accounting procedures.

Thorough knowledge of rules and regulations of keeping accounting records.

Knowledge of and ability to process routine and semi-complex payroll, including hours of work and overtime provisions of the Fair Labor Standards Act.

Knowledge of business English and arithmetic.

Ability to analyze, evaluate and resolve complex accounting, billing and payroll problems

Ability to apply accounting principles to computerized maintenance of financial and accounting transactions.

Ability to skillfully operate computers and relevant software and other business machines.

Ability to perform front-end editing of financial data to ensure accuracy and resolve issues.

Ability to make mathematical calculations with reasonable speed and accuracy.

Veterans' Preference

Veterans are encouraged to apply. Veterans’ Preference ensures that veterans and eligible persons are given consideration at each step of the selection process. However, preference does not guarantee that a veteran or other eligible person will be the candidate selected to fill the position. Section 295.07, Florida Statutes (F.S.) specifies who is eligible for Veterans’ Preference. State of Florida residency is not required for Veterans’ Preference.
